Swamp Sparrow Sighting
You have to be alert if you hope to find
this shy forager hiding in the marshlands
was walking through a grassy point
of land at the Hog Island Wildlife
Management Area along the James
River in Virginia. The terrain was
sparsely scattered with pines, other trees
and shrubs. The edges consisted of a
variety of grasses and marsh vegetation
of numerous species. I was so
concentrated on getting out to the point
where a flock of waterfowl was gathered
that I didn't pay attention to the small
birds around me. I suddenly realized I
was being escorted by a group of brown
birds, uttering a buzzy " sweet-sweet "
call. They kept low in the vegetation,
moving ahead of me, pumping their
tails as they flew. It then dawned on me
that these were swamp sparrows.
THE SONG OF THE SPARROW
Swamp sparrows are one of the least
known of our common sparrows. They
are found in freshwater marshes or
marshy areas and swamps. They are not
often seen or identified because of the
habitat in which they live and their
tendency to be secretive or shy, as they
forage low in the tall marsh vegetation.
They also are identified by their rapid,
metallic, loud trill of " weet-weet-weet "
or call note of " chink. "
Like other sparrows, they are
basically brown, gray and chestnut
brown, with black, gray and white
markings. They are plain gray on their
underside with buffy flanks and brown
underparts streaked with black and a
dark reddish-brown rump. Among the
most distinctive field marks are a
chestnut crown, reddish-brown wings
and a light gray face. They measure
about 5 3/4 inches in length.
As mentioned, swamp sparrows are
birds of freshwater marshes, wet fields,
bogs or streams edged with various
emergent plants and grasses, as well
as trees like willow and alder. They
have been known to wade in the water
like shorebirds and have been observed

sticking their heads underwater
to feed on aquatic
insects and larvae. They also
feed on plant seeds and fruits.
WHEN SPARROWS APPEAR
While normally sticking
low in the dense vegetation,
they will come out in the open
during nesting. Males sing from
the tops of marsh vegetation or
low-growing shrubs. The nests
of swamp sparrows are built low
or even on the ground along
the marshy edges. The nest
is located in a clump of
older vegetation, lowgrowing
shrubs or grassy
tussock. It is mainly

constructed of grasses and
leaves, and lined with fine
grass. The cup-shaped
structure often has a side
entrance. The birds lay four
or five eggs, which are pale
blue or pale green or bluish white,
with markings of yellow-brown
or lilac.
Swamp sparrows breed over the
northern tier of states in eastern North
America as well as in Canada. Some
may migrate in winter to the Gulf
Coast, but being a hardy bird, many
will stay in Atlantic coastal regions
throughout the winter. 
